Committee Meeting on the Human Genetics Resource Preservation Center of Hubei Province Held in Zhongnan Hospital of Wuhan University

On March 20th, 2018, a committee meeting on the Human Genetics Resource Preservation Center of Hubei Province was held by the Science and Technology Department of Hubei Province and the Health and Family Planning Commission of Hubei Province in Zhongnan Hospital of Wuhan University. Experts from government, universities and hospitals, including Professor Xinghuan Wang, the president of Zhongnan Hospital of Wuhan University, Professor Jun Lin, vice party committee secretary, Jianying Huang, commissioner of Research Office, Dr. Yu Xiao, the director of Department of Biological Repositories, Sheng Li, vice director of Department of Biological Repositories, attended the meeting.

 

The committee meeting was chaired by Mingjie Wei, division chief of the Science and Technology Department of Hubei Province. Dr. Yu introduced the main work of the Human Genetics Resource Preservation Center of Hubei Province and answered the questions proposed by the experts from Beijing Cancer Hospital, Kunming Institute of Zoology, Chinese Academy of Sciences, Beijing Hospital, Huazhong Agricultural University, Ruijin Hospital, School of Medicine of Shanghai Jiaotong University, the First Affiliated Hospital of Xi'an Jiao Tong University, Fuwai Hospital, and Chinese Academy of Medical Sciences. After the introduction, questioning, and discussion, all the experts on the panel agreed that Human Genetics Resource Preservation Center of Hubei Province should be founded at Zhongnan Hospital of Wuhan University. The experts also suggested that Human Genetics Resource Preservation Center of Hubei Province build a sound operating system and an effective sharing mode to strengthen information construction and to reach the international leading level at a regional scale.
